Why Coffee Oil Residue Builds Up in the First Place
What Coffee Oils Are
Coffee beans contain lipids, collectively called coffee oils, that carry a significant portion of the flavor and aroma you taste in the cup. During brewing, heat and pressure extract those lipids along with the solubles you want. Some end up in your drink. The rest coat whatever surface the brew touches: the inside of a carafe, the walls of a portafilter basket, the screen of a pour-over dripper.
On a freshly brewed surface, that oily film is nearly invisible. You might rinse it away without thinking about it. The trouble starts when you rinse incompletely or skip washing altogether. The oils oxidize as they sit, picking up a sharp, almost fishy odor and a bitter edge that will transfer directly into your next cup.
When Oils Turn Rancid
Rancid coffee oils develop within 24 to 48 hours at room temperature, faster if the equipment is warm or the residue is thick. The smell is distinctive: stale, a little acrid, sometimes faintly metallic. If your coffee has been tasting oddly bitter even when you dial in a fresh dose of good beans, residue is usually the first thing to check.
Brown staining on mugs and glass is a separate layer of the same problem. Tannins from the brewed coffee bond with the surface over time, leaving marks that plain water will not touch. They are cosmetic rather than flavor-affecting, but they confirm that the equipment needs a proper clean rather than a quick rinse.
Cleaning Coffee Stains on Mugs and Carafes
The Baking Soda Method
Baking soda is mildly abrasive and completely odorless, which makes it ideal for ceramic mugs and glass carafes. Add 1 to 2 teaspoons (about 5 to 10 g) of baking soda to the stained vessel, add just enough warm water (around 120°F / 49°C) to make a paste or thin slurry, and let it sit for 5 minutes. Then scrub with a soft sponge or cloth. The light abrasive action lifts the tannin layer without scratching most glazed surfaces.
For heavier staining inside a narrow-mouth carafe where a sponge will not reach, fill it halfway with warm water, add 2 teaspoons of baking soda, and drop in a small bottle brush. Let the carafe soak for 15 to 20 minutes, then scrub and rinse thoroughly.
When Vinegar Helps
White vinegar (5% acidity, straight from the bottle) works well on glass surfaces where you need the acid to cut through mineral deposits and oil residue at the same time. Fill the stained carafe or mug halfway, top with hot water at roughly 160°F / 71°C, and let it soak for 30 minutes. The vinegar smell dissipates completely with two or three thorough rinses. Avoid using vinegar on stainless steel interiors repeatedly over time, as the acid can affect the finish.
Do not mix vinegar and baking soda inside the vessel expecting a stronger effect. The two neutralize each other on contact and the fizzing is mostly theater. Pick one approach for each session.
Removing Coffee Oil Residue From Brewers and Portafilters
Espresso Group Heads and Portafilters
Espresso equipment accumulates the densest coffee oil residue of anything in a home setup because of the combination of high pressure, fine grounds, and elevated temperatures. A portafilter basket that is only rinsed after each shot will develop a thick brown crust within a week or two.
For daily cleaning, knock the puck, then knock the basket against a damp cloth and rinse under hot tap water (140°F / 60°C or higher) while scrubbing the inside with a stiff nylon brush. That handles the loose grounds, but it does not remove the oily film. Once a week, soak the portafilter basket and shower screen in hot water with a small amount of espresso machine cleaner (most are sodium percarbonate-based) for 20 to 30 minutes, then rinse until the water runs clear and odorless.

Pour-Over and Drip Equipment
Pour-over drippers (ceramic, glass, or plastic) can be washed with a small amount of unscented dish soap and a soft brush after each session. Rinse until the soap smell is fully gone before the next brew. Plastic drippers pick up oils more readily than ceramic and may need a 15-minute soak in warm soapy water once a week.
Glass carafes for drip machines benefit from the baking soda method described above. Pay attention to the spout and the base of the carafe, where residue pools. Thermal carafes with stainless steel interiors should be cleaned with a product rated for that surface; dish soap and a long-handled brush work for routine cleaning, but a percarbonate tablet dissolved in hot water (around 170°F / 77°C) and left for 20 minutes handles buildup in hard-to-reach spots.
Cleaning Coffee Residue From Grinders
Grinder cleaning is where the approach changes most sharply. You cannot submerge burrs or a hopper in water unless you are fully prepared to disassemble and dry every component over 24 to 48 hours before reassembling. Water in the wrong spot will rust steel burrs or swell wooden parts.
The most practical routine for flat or conical burr grinders is dry brushing. Use the small brush that came with the grinder (or a clean, soft-bristle paintbrush) to sweep grounds and oily residue from the burr faces and the upper and lower burr chambers every week or two, depending on how much you grind.
For deeper cleaning, grinder-cleaning tablets (rice-shaped, food-safe) work well. Run a small dose through the grinder on a medium setting, then discard the output and run a small amount of coffee to purge. The tablets absorb oils and pull them through without moisture. Follow the tablet weight specified in your grinder's documentation, typically around 35 to 40 g.

How Often to Clean Each Piece of Gear
Frequency matters as much as method. Here is a straightforward schedule for home brewing:
| Equipment | Rinse After Use | Light Clean | Deep Clean |
|---|---|---|---|
| Mug or carafe | Every use | Weekly (baking soda) | Monthly if stained |
| Portafilter / basket | Every shot | Weekly (soak) | Monthly (percarbonate) |
| Pour-over dripper | Every use | Weekly (soap + brush) | Monthly |
| Espresso group head | Every session | Weekly (backflush) | Per machine manual |
| Burr grinder | After heavy use | Every 1-2 weeks (brush) | Monthly (tablets) |
| Drip machine | After each pot | Weekly (carafe) | Per descaling guide |
The rinse-after-use step is the highest-leverage habit. Most residue is still soft and moveable with hot water in the first few minutes. Letting it sit overnight is what starts the oxidation process that turns routine cleaning into a scrubbing session.
Frequently Asked Questions
What exactly is coffee oil residue?
Coffee oil residue is the thin film of lipids left behind on equipment after brewing. These fats are naturally present in coffee beans and extract into the brew, but a portion clings to whatever surface the coffee touches. Over time the film oxidizes, darkens, and develops an off-flavor that carries into subsequent cups.
Why does my coffee taste bitter even when I use fresh beans?
Stale or rancid coffee oil residue is one of the most common culprits. Even well-dialed-in espresso or pour-over will taste sharp and bitter if it passes through equipment coated in oxidized oils. Before adjusting your grind or dose, clean all equipment thoroughly and brew a test cup. The difference is often immediate.
Is regular dish soap safe for coffee gear?
Unscented dish soap is safe for ceramic, glass, and plastic surfaces used in pour-over and drip brewing. Use it sparingly and rinse thoroughly, since soap residue has its own off-flavor. Avoid dish soap inside espresso machines and inside grinder chambers, where residue is harder to fully rinse and where the interaction with steam or fine particles creates additional problems.
How do I know if my coffee oils have gone rancid?
Sniff the equipment before brewing. Rancid oils have a stale, slightly sour or fishy smell that is quite different from the pleasant lingering aroma of fresh coffee. If the basket, dripper, or carafe smells off when dry, it will affect the cup. A deep clean before the next brew is the right call.
Can I use bleach to remove coffee stains on mugs?
Bleach will remove coffee staining from ceramic mugs, but it requires extremely thorough rinsing afterward and is generally overkill for the task. A 20-minute baking soda soak removes even heavy staining from most ceramic surfaces without the rinsing risk. Save bleach for sanitation tasks where nothing else works.
